Berlin Pride attack kills one, injures 29; Hamburg reviews security for next week's CSD parade
A car drove into a crowd at Berlin's Christopher Street Day celebrations late Saturday, killing a woman and injuring 29 people. Authorities have classified it as an Islamist terrorist attack, and Hamburg is reviewing security for its own Pride parade next weekend.

CDU rejects new Linke chief's apology for calling party 'fascist', demands resignation
Newly elected Die Linke co-chair Luigi Pantisano apologized Monday for claiming there is 'no difference' between CDU, AfD and 'the fascists themselves,' but CDU General Secretary Carsten Linnemann dismissed the apology as 'an impertinence' and reiterated his demand that Pantisano resign.

Hamburg votes 'No' to Olympics for second time, reshaping Germany's 2036-2044 bid race
In a binding referendum, 54.9% of Hamburg voters rejected a bid for the 2036, 2040, or 2044 Summer Games, echoing their 2015 decision and dealing a blow to national Olympic ambitions.
